Step-by-Step Setup Guide at Trezor.io/Start

1. Go to the Official Setup Page

Visit trezor.io/start. Select your device: Trezor One or Model T.

2. Install Trezor Suite

Trezor Suite is the official desktop and browser interface for managing your wallet. Download it securely from the site.

3. Connect Your Trezor® Device

Plug your Trezor into your computer or smartphone using the USB cable. You’ll be prompted to install the latest firmware if it's a new device.

4. Create a New Wallet

Choose “Create New Wallet” and follow the instructions on your device and the app.

Important: You will be shown a 12 or 24-word recovery seed. Write this down on paper and never store it digitally.

5. Confirm Recovery Seed

Trezor will ask you to confirm specific words from your recovery seed to ensure it's saved correctly.

6. Set a PIN

Add a PIN for local device security. This prevents unauthorized users from accessing your funds if they have your device.

7. Access Your Dashboard

You’re now ready to send, receive, and manage your crypto assets directly from the Trezor Suite dashboard.

Recovery Process

Lost or damaged device? No problem—your assets can be recovered using your 12/24-word seed phrase:

  1. Buy or borrow a new Trezor
  2. Select “Recover Wallet” during setup
  3. Enter your recovery seed carefully

This will restore your entire wallet and access to your funds.
